A seven-weight humanist sans with calligraphic roots, derived from Zetafonts' own Digitalino and suited to corporate and editorial work.

About

Expanded from Francesco Canovaro's original bold design for Digitalino, Altair runs from Thin to Ultra across 14 styles including matching italics. Its calligraphic underpinning gives the letterforms a warmth that suits brand voices and editorial contexts where a neutral grotesque would feel too cold. Coverage extends to 202 languages across Latin and Greek scripts.

Classification

Altair is derived from the calligraphic Digitalino typeface, giving it humanist roots with organic stroke contrast that distinguishes it from geometric or grotesque sans-serif traditions.
